Shadrach, Meshach, and Abednego believed God could save them from the fire, but their faith was not dependent on the outcome. “Even if” is the language of a faith that trusts God’s character, not just his answers.
Whatever you are facing, may your heart move from fear-filled “what ifs” to faithful “even ifs.” God is still worthy of your trust.

God did not keep Shadrach, Meshach, and Abednego from the furnace. He met them in it. He did not keep Daniel from the lions’ den. He was with him there. He did not keep Joseph from the pit or the prison. He stayed with him through it all.
Whatever you are walking through, you are not alone. The same God who was faithful then is faithful now.
